“If you want peace, prepare for war.” “A buildup of offensive weapons can be purely defensive.” “The worst road may be the best route to battle.” Strategy is made of such seemingly self-contradictory propositions, Edward Luttwak shows—they exemplify the paradoxical logic that pervades the entire realm of conflict.In this widely acclaimed work, now revised and expanded, Luttwak unveils the peculiar logic of strategy level by level, from grand strategy down to combat tactics. Having participated in its planning, Luttwak examines the role of air power in the 1991 Gulf War, then detects the emergence of “post-heroic” war in Kosovo in 1999—an American war in which not a single American soldier was killed.In the tradition of Carl von Clausewitz, Strategy goes beyond paradox to expose the dynamics of reversal at work in the crucible of conflict. As victory is turned into defeat by over-extension, as war brings peace by exhaustion, ordinary linear logic is overthrown. Citing examples from ancient Rome to our own days, from Barbarossa and Pearl Harbor down to minor combat affrays, from the strategy of peace to the latest operational methods of war, this book by one of the world’s foremost authorities reveals the ultimate logic of military failure and success, of war and peace.

The new US National Cyber Strategy points to Russia, China, North Korea and Iran as the main international actors responsible for launching malicious cyber and information warfare campaigns against Western interests and democratic processes. Washington made clear its intention of scaling the response to the magnitude of the threat, while actively pursuing the goal of an open, secure and global Internet. The first Report of the ISPI Center on Cybersecurity focuses on the behaviour of these “usual suspects”, investigates the security risks implicit in the mounting international confrontation in cyberspace, and highlights the current irreconcilable political cleavage between these four countries and the West in their respective approaches “in and around” cyberspace.

This Festschrift commemorates the 50th anniversary of the foundation of the Clausewitz-Society in the Federal Republic of Germany of 1961. This volume follows the intentions of the Clausewitz-Society as described by one of its former presidents: “to view the current tasks of politics and strategy as reflected in the insights of Carl von Clausewitz and thus examine which of the principles and insights formulated by Clausewitz are still important today and are thus endowed with an enduring validity”. The board and the members of the Clausewitz-Society therefore supported the idea to examine how and when the works of Clausewitz have been interpreted in selected countries of our world; further, the goal here has been to analyze the role that Clausewitz’s thought still plays in these countries. Pochi sostantivi hanno avuto una diffusione e un successo comparabili a quelli conosciuti da “strategia”. Tanto che il termine è oramai utilizzato nei più diversi ambiti dell’azione, interazione e progettazione, sociale e non, con esiti a volte paradossali. Tutto pare essere “strategico” e, di fatto, nel linguaggio corrente l’aggettivo indica una qualsiasi azione comunque rilevante, di vasta portata e/o lungo periodo. Nell’ambito originario di pertinenza strategia era tuttavia l’arte o scienza della preparazione e conduzione efficace della guerra, in vista del conseguimento dei suoi obbiettivi. Quest’origine e la connotazione operativa che le è associata ne spiegano il successo e la migrazione ai contesti i più diversi: economico e dell’impresa, del marketing, comunicativo. I saggi inclusi in questo volume ricostruiscono la teoria strategica in prospettive disciplinari diverse, tradizionali e non: politico-militare, economica, semiotica, psicologica, della comunicazione. Scopo ultimo è intrecciare un dialogo orientato a una teoria generale dell’azione di successo, a fronte di opposizione consapevole, che si applichi dai giochi da tavolo alle nuove guerre del mondo contemporaneo.

Quello di Costantinopoli è stato un caso unico nella storia: mille anni di dominio incontrastato su un impero vastissimo e multietnico. Dal IV secolo fino alla caduta, avvenuta nel 1453 per mano di Maometto II, l'Impero romano d'Oriente è sopravvissuto al gemello d'Occidente, ha retto l'onda d'urto degli Unni, degli Slavi, degli Arabi e degli altri che nei secoli hanno cercato di sfondare il limes. Eppure la forza militare, la posizione e le risorse non erano neppure lontanamente paragonabili a quelle di Roma. Come è stato possibile? Bisanzio elaborò una strategia politica e militare efficacissima, basata su un uso estremamente moderno di quella che oggi chiameremmo "intelligence". La diplomazia dell'Impero romano d'Oriente seppe imbrigliare le forze nemiche raccogliendo dettagliati dossier e riuscendo a ottenere vantaggiose concessioni a tutti i tavoli di trattativa. Sul fronte militare, cercò di conservare la pace il più a lungo possibile: mantenne alta la tensione agendo come se la guerra fosse sempre imminente, ma scese in battaglia solo quando aveva buone possibilità di vittoria. Nella politica interna, privilegiò l'integrazione e l'assorbimento per sfruttare il patrimonio di culture, tecnologie e conoscenze che ogni popolo assoggettato portava in dote.
